#2. Chicken Wings

Wings are popular party eats because they’re quick, easy, and versatile. If you’ve been to a Superbowl (or any football game, for that matter) watch party, you know that these babies are staples. Whether you fry, grill, or bake them, they’ll still come out looking and tasting great. 

For faster prep time, buy the party wings variant so you won’t have to cut them yourself. Also, this kind is much easier for guests to eat. As for the cooking part, feel free to experiment with your flavors! There are tons of different options out there, from the classic Buffalo to the crunch almond-crusted kind.

 

#3. Chips and Dip

Here’s another quick and easy party snack that’s a hit with the masses. The combination of crunchy chips and rich dips is just one of those pairs that make total sense, you know?

Like chicken wings, chips and dip are a versatile party snack. Chip choices are endless; you can go for the good ol’ potato or a healthy option like kale. Dip varieties vary, too—from salsa to tzatziki, the options are aplenty. And the best part? All you need is pantry items to get you started.

When making this party hit, your dips shouldn’t be too thick; otherwise, it’ll break the chips when your guests try to scoop them up.

#6. Antipasto Platter

This Italian staple gets tastebuds excited due to its wealth of flavors and textures. But, of course, it helps that it looks great, too.  

Assembling a platter may seem daunting, but it’s a lot less stressful than it looks. Just find the meat and cheese combination that works for you. Your veggies (regardless if they’re fresh, cooked, or marinated) should be good to go as well, especially if you’re in a hurry. Feel free to add extras like sliced fruits and nuts for pizzazz. Lastly, your plate should be big enough for everything to fit. Trust us—you don’t want extra cleanups courtesy of spills.
